On the NOVA processing scale, Pillsbury, Funfetti, Vanilla Glazed Lil' Donut Kit is classified as Group 4 (Ultra-processed). NOVA measures industrial processing intensity rather than ingredient-level safety, so it complements the SAFFA and CSPI ratings: a product can be clean on additive flags but heavily processed, or lightly processed but carry individually flagged ingredients. Combining both lenses gives a fuller picture than either alone.

Full Ingredient List

Donut Mix: Enriched Flour (Wheat Flour, Malted Barley Flour, Niacin, Reduced Iron, Thiamin Mononitrate, Riboflavin, Folic Acid), Sugar, Partially Hydrogenated Soybean Oil, Candy Bits (Sugar, Partially Hydrogenated Cottonseed And Soybean Oils, Corn Starch, Modified Corn Starch, Confectioner'S Glaze, Soy Lecithin, Colored With [Red 40, Yellow 5, Yellow 6, Blue 1]), Contains 2% Or Less Of: Buttermilk, Leavening (Baking Soda, Sodium Acid Pyrophosphate, Sodium Aluminum Phosphate), Dextrose, Cellulose, Modified Corn Starch, Natural And Artificial Flavors, Cultured Acidified Skim Milk, Salt, Corn Starch, Xanthan Gum. Glaze Mix: Sugar, Corn Starch, Natural And Artificial Flavor. Candy Bits: Sugar, Corn Starch, Partially Hydrogenated Soybean And Cottonseed Oils, Soy Lecithin, Dextrin, Confectioner'S Glaze, Red 40 Lake, Natural And Artificial Flavor, Yellow 6 Lake, Carnauba Wax, Blue 1 Lake, Yellow 5 Lake, Red 3, Red 40.
